**np.polyfromroots()**方法用于生成给定根的多项式级数。

语法: np.polyfromroots(roots) 参数: 根:【array _ like】输入包含根的序列。

返回:【n 数组】多项式级数系数的一维数组。

代码#1 :

# Python program explaining
# numpy.polyfromroots() method 

# importing numpy as np  
# and numpy.polynomial.polynomial module as geek 
import numpy as np 
import numpy.polynomial.polynomial as geek

# Input roots

roots = (2, 4, 8) 

# using np.polyfromroots() method 
res = geek.polyfromroots(roots) 

# Resulting polynomial series coefficient
print (res) 

Output:

[-64\.  56\. -14\.   1.]
